What Does TIFF Stand For

TIFF stands for Tagged Image File Format. It is a flexible file format developed by Aldus Corporation (now Adobe) in 1986 which supports multiple layers of information such as color depth, image compression, spot colors, alpha channels and layer support.

Uses

TIFF is able to represent digital data with high resolution accuracy while maintaining compatibility with many different types of software applications. This makes it ideal for use in printing applications since the exactness of the image can be maintained across various devices. Images stored in the TIFF format are commonly used for desktop publishing (DTP), digital photography, medical imaging and other tasks where exact color definition is important. They are also typically used when archiving scanned documents as this type of file format can store a lot more information than some other formats such as JPEG or GIF.

How does TIFF compress files?

TIFF supports both lossless (no data loss) and lossy (some data loss) compression techniques. Lossless techniques include run-length encoding which looks for repetitive patterns in pixels within an image to reduce file size while still maintaining its original detail. Lossy compression techniques include JPEG/JPEG 2000 which removes redundant information from the source image, allowing it to be reduced further while still maintaining most of its original quality.
